Structure Related Problems of the 1996 Nissan Quest

Table 1 shows three common structure related problems of the 1996 Nissan Quest. The number one most common problem is related to the door (14 problems). The second most common problem is related to the door hinge (one problem).

The Frame Rust problem

The contact owns a 1996 Nissan Quest. While inspecting the vehicle, it was discovered that the rear passenger side subframe was rusted and corroded. The cause of the failure was not diagnosed.
